计数器为什么会错位

2020-02-28 18:24发布

counter是计数器,时钟上升沿计数一次
为什么这样一个语句 if counter>=2 and counter<=4then
                              x<=0;
                            else x<=1;
用modelsim仿真后,波形显示是当计数器counter为3、4、5时x为0,其他时候为1,而不是想要的当counter为2、3、4时x为0,其他时候为1
友情提示: 此问题已得到解决,问题已经关闭,关闭后问题禁止继续编辑,回答。